Frequently Asked Questions

What are the typical salary ranges by seniority for Supportive Work Environment roles?
Entry‑level Wellness Coordinators earn $45,000–$60,000, mid‑level Culture Officers or Employee Relations Managers command $60,000–$80,000, and senior leaders such as VP of People or Chief Diversity Officers earn $90,000–$130,000 depending on company size and region.
Which skills and certifications are essential in this field?
Key skills: empathetic communication, conflict resolution, data analytics, and program design. Tool proficiency: HRIS platforms like Workday or BambooHR, culture survey tools such as Culture Amp or Officevibe, wellness apps like Headspace, and collaboration suites like Slack or Teams. Certifications: SHRM‑CP/SCP, PHR/SPHR, Certified Employee Assistance Program (CEAP), and CPLP for learning professionals.
Is remote work available for Supportive Work Environment positions?
Yes, many roles—especially Wellness Coordinators, L&D Specialists, and Virtual Employee Relations Managers—are fully remote or hybrid. Success depends on mastery of virtual onboarding, asynchronous training tools, and remote engagement platforms.
What career progression paths exist in this category?
Typical trajectories move from Wellness Coordinator to Senior Wellness Manager, then to People Operations Manager, VP of People, and ultimately Chief People Officer. Learning specialists can progress from Learning Coordinator to L&D Manager, Director of L&D, and Chief Learning Officer.
What industry trends are shaping Supportive Work Environment roles?
Current trends include increased focus on mental health and resilience, AI‑driven engagement analytics, gamified wellness programs, remote‑first culture strategies, data privacy compliance for employee data, and a stronger emphasis on DEI metrics and reporting.
